According to a new report from fraud protection and authentication company Pindrop, 52 per cent of fraudulent calls made to UK financial insti
Our partnerships are powerful. We deliver broader, longer-lasting impact in our work through collaboration.
* I would like to receive & communication regarding products, services and events. I can unsubscribe any time. View our Privacy Policy.